Sviluppo e integrazione
In qualità di Partner di Shopify, puoi creare soluzioni di grande impatto per i merchant sviluppando app e temi su misura per le loro esigenze.
In questa pagina
Dev Dashboard
La Dev Dashboard è l’hub centrale per la creazione e la gestione delle app di Shopify. Dalla Dev Dashboard puoi effettuare le seguenti operazioni:
- Creare e configurare app utilizzando Shopify CLI o direttamente nella Dev Dashboard.
- Creare e gestire i negozi, inclusi development store, negozi in fase di trasferimento al cliente e collaborazioni.
- Monitorare le prestazioni dell’app con log e metriche integrati.
- Gestire le autorizzazioni utente per l’organizzazione.
Se in precedenza gestivi le app e i development store tramite la Partner Dashboard, consulta la guida alla migrazione per scoprire cos’è cambiato.
Scopri di più sulla Dev Dashboard.
Creazione di app
Puoi sviluppare e monetizzare le app utilizzando i seguenti metodi:
- App personalizzate: sviluppa app personalizzate per rispondere alle esigenze specifiche dei clienti. Queste app sono su misura per i singoli merchant e le loro esigenze specifiche.
- App pubbliche: crea app pubbliche da distribuire attraverso lo Shopify App Store. Assicurati che le tue app soddisfino i requisiti di Shopify per le app dello Shopify App Store.
- Documentazione API: usa la documentazione API di Shopify e segui la guida introduttiva per capire come sviluppare la tua app in modo efficace.
- Suggerimenti per il successo: consulta i suggerimenti per il successo per migliorare la visibilità e le performance della tua app dopo il lancio.
- Dati e analisi: dopo aver lanciato l'app, monitorane le performance con dati dettagliati su entrate e installazioni per comprendere il coinvolgimento degli utenti e il successo finanziario.
Puoi anche sviluppare temi utilizzando i seguenti strumenti e risorse:
- Temi personalizzati o di riferimento: crea temi da zero oppure crea un tema utilizzando il tema Skeleton, un tema di riferimento che funge da punto di partenza flessibile per i tuoi design.
- Design adattivo: sfrutta Liquid per creare contenuti dinamici e implementare design adattivi con HTML, CSS e JavaScript per una user experience fluida su tutti i dispositivi.
- Requisiti del Theme Store: assicurati che i tuoi temi siano conformi ai requisiti del Theme Store di Shopify.
- Procedura di invio e revisione: acquisisci familiarità con le linee guida per la revisione e l'invio dei temi per semplificare la procedura di approvazione.
Risorse per gli sviluppatori
Mentre sviluppi app o temi, puoi utilizzare le seguenti risorse come aiuto per lo sviluppo e la risoluzione di eventuali problemi:
- Assicurati di lavorare con la Shopify API aggiornata per evitare problemi di compatibilità che potrebbero causare errori o ridurre il posizionamento nei risultati di ricerca della tua app o del tuo tema.
- Chatta con l'assistente .dev su shopify.dev cliccando sulla ricerca e quindi su Apri assistente. L'assistente .dev può aiutarti a risolvere incongruenze o errori e a rispondere alle tue domande sulla programmazione.
- Fai domande ad altri Partner di Shopify e sviluppatori sulla community .dev.